The Shift Logistics Executive holds overall responsibility for the Control of Full Stock / Preparation and Reporting of MIS reports. His main function is to prepare Daily FMR (Full Movement Report) of Plant/DPGP/SRGD and reconcile differences. He has to handle floor operation, Inventory & fleet plus exposure to some warehouse ERP, WMS, 5S & other common warehouse / transport practices.
Job Responsibilities
Daily preparation of FMR (full movement report) of Plant/DPGP/SRGD & reconcile differences (if any) on a daily basis
On time generation & reporting of MIS reports
Flag off critical stock / FIFO non compliance on a regular basis
Month end stock reconciliation and submit the report to finance as per closing schedule.
Accurate accounting and book entry for sale return.
Ensure zero deviation in full transferred from production (FTP)
Check all unloading related documentation and sign off
Issue & receipt empties from production and reconcile with production
Supervise daily stock taking of empties / shells & identify shortages
Daily updating Breakage register
Controlling & reducing breakages during empty loading & unloading
Carry out inventory control of empty glasses inventory
Update FRA and invoices of DPGP/SRGD on daily Basis.
Accurate adjustment entry in system for any identified deviations
Ensure daily updating of critical stock board
Ensure TPM slates and DOD stickering are being updated everyday.
Dispatches as per plan and orders
Arranging and allocation of trucks according to the load and capability.
Tally invoice to distributor order. Sign off and get the truck driver’s sign there in the invoice.
